#316809 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#316809 is composed of 19.2% red, 40.8%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 94.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 22.2%. #316809 color hex could be obtained by blending #62d012 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#316809 color description : Very dark green.
#316809 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#316809 has RGB values of R:49, G:104,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 3237897.

Shades and Tints of #316809
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060e01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#316809
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383d34 is the less saturated color, while #307100 is the most saturated one.
